Instructions: In a bowl, stir together the lime juice, soy sauce, sugar, salt and oil and rub the mixture onto both sides of each salmon steak. Let the salmon stand for 15 minutes. Heat an oiled ridged pan over moderately high heat until it is smoking and in it saute the salmon for 3 to 4 minutes on each side, or until it just flakes and is cooked through. Transfer thew salmon to heated plates and serve with the lime wedges.
Serves 2. NOTE: You can also cook this on the grill. Email this Recipe:
